Description
Navigating the Maze of Nursing Research: An Interactive Learning Adventure has been created as an interactive learning package including a CD and accompanying website designed to make research casual and fun. Suitable for students studying nursing research for the first time, the package is designed to introduce the language of nursing research and to teach students how to find, assess, evaluate, and apply nursing research in a variety of clinical settings. It also enhances students' skills such as reading and sourcing information from libraries and the internet. All components of the package – text, CD and website – have been adapted to reflect current Australian and New Zealand practice.

Audience
For nursing students studying research for the first time.
